The north's reputation for unusual animal incidents is growing (states thfc Northern Advocate). The latest animal to claim the honour is a 13-months-old goat belonging to Mr Bryers, Maunu, which has produced triplets. The young family is doing well, but as a goat is only able to feed two young ones at a time, a bottle_ has had to be provided for the third arrival.
